Complete issue in 2 volumes. British School of Archaeology in Iraq, London, 1972. In-8, 150 pages. Original softcover, a fine copy. Contents: Vol. 1: Spring 1972: Obituary Sir John Troutbeck. - Umm Dabaghiyah 1971 : a preliminary report, D. Kirkbride. - Traces of plants in the early ceramic site of Umm Dabaghiyah, H. Helbaek. - A letter from Samas-Sumu-Ukin to Esarhaddon, S. Parpola. - Samarran irrigation agriculture at Choga Mami in Iraq, H. Helbaek. - A radiocarbon date from Choga Mami, J. Oates. - Some comments on archive keeping at Mari, J.M. Sasson. - A note on the geomorphology of the country near Umm Dabaghiyah, P. Dorrell. - Some Sumerian statues in the Iraq museum, L. al-Gailani. - Vol. 2, Autumn 1972: The excavations at Tell al Rimah, 1971, D. Oates. - The neo-Assyrian court and army: evidence from the sculptures, J.E. Reade. - The archaeological uses of cuneiform documents, McGuire Gibson. - Seals from the Hutchinson collection, S. Dalley. - Some Aramaic epigraphs, A.R. Millard. - Excavations in Iraq. Language: English. Relevant subjects: Mesopotamia, Journals Near East.
